A checklist is intentionally modular so services can be removed when they do not fit the unit, association rules, or legal scope.
Interior condition
Visible water/moisture signs
Doors/windows visual condition
Wall/ceiling condition notes
Obvious pest/damage observations
Appliance check
Visual condition
Optional basic run-test
Temperature / operation note if requested
Create repair request when needed
Consumables
A/C filter change only
Smoke/CO batteries
Light bulbs
Owner-specified safe consumables
Small maintenance
Cabinet/door adjustments
Caulk touch-up
Minor wall/paint touch-up
Approved punch-list items
Documentation
Date-stamped work order
Notes by item
Photo documentation by request
Follow-up recommendation
Escalation
If a check finds a problem outside handyman scope, the item is documented and referred for the appropriate licensed trade rather than being improvised.
